Output cba7d0ac86c15261e9832c602915e691c02b2d75fa267f59c1892911ebf17a45:0

value
70916
script pubkey
OP_HASH160 OP_PUSHBYTES_20 886adf47ff43ce60a74ae2f5522cf56aeec6228c OP_EQUAL
address
3E8KrF31jdHjpCGVxavX453umQihY9wDww
transaction
cba7d0ac86c15261e9832c602915e691c02b2d75fa267f59c1892911ebf17a45
confirmations
276697
spent
true